Overview
- France Football confirmed the Arsenal striker as the men’s winner in Paris, with Gyökeres also placing 15th in Ballon d’Or voting.
- Outlets report different season totals for 2024/25 — frequently 63 or 54 — underscoring confusion over his exact tally even as he leads the raw count.
- After joining Arsenal this summer, he has scored three times in his first five Premier League matches as adaptation to Mikel Arteta’s system continues.
- Spanish papers Marca and AS questioned his win over Kylian Mbappé, while UK voices offered mixed views, with Jamie Carragher highlighting a lack of service in big games.
- Analysts note games with no shots and limited touches for Gyökeres at Arsenal, and the player himself says elite scorers rely on teams that create chances.
